I was actual going to post about something else when this issue came up. So as I'm sitting here typing, occasionally the cursor moves back a space in the middle of a word. It's happening too often for it to be something I'm doing. Also the space bar doesn't always take. It could be the soda I spilled on the keyboard the other day, but this is the first problem I've had with it, and I thought I cleaned it up pretty thoroughly. Never the less, I'm going to take it apart and try again, but do you have any suggestions if that isn't the problem?

It's probably the soda, and even if you take it apart and clean it again, if any got inside, you're hooped. It only takes a drop to really fark things up. If you've got a spare, or can borrow a spare from someone, that's the best way to make sure. Otherwise, do some deep scans in safe mode for virii and malware, as it can be a symptom. After that, defrag/scan disk if you haven't done those recently. That's a really long shot, but maybe. Someone else will probably have other suggestions.

Depending on the type of keyboard, you can take it apart and clean it.
But unless it is a really good keyboard, it isn't worth it. You can buy a new cheapie one for five bucks.
